MRI Technician Jobs in Philadelphia, PA
An MRI (Magnetic Resonance Imaging) Technician plays a crucial role in the radiology field by operating MRI machines, which use magnetic field and radio waves to generate images of the body's internal structures, aiding in diagnosis and treatment of medical conditions. These technicians position patients for scanning, monitor patient safety during the process, adjust imaging parameters, and ensure the production of high-quality images. They also assist radiologists in interpreting the images and provide patient education about the MRI process. Further, they maintain records, upkeep equipment, and adhere to safety regulations and procedures.
Important skills for an MRI Technician include strong technical skills, attention to detail, good physical stamina, excellent communication, and compassion. They should be certified in MRI technology, often requiring a certification from the American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(ARRT) or similar bodies. Prior to becoming an MRI Technician, one could have roles such as a Radiologic Technologist or a Diagnostic Medical Sonographer. Some might also start as a Patient Care Technician or a Medical Assistant in a healthcare setting, gaining valuable experience in patient care and medical procedures.
